Matilda (Bentz) Johnson – December 30, 1887 – October 17, 1931

MRS. THEODORE JOHNSON OF ROCKFORD IS BURIED

Rockford, Oct. 20 – Mrs. Theodore Johnson died at her home here Saturday morning following an illness of about three months.
Funeral services were held yesterday afternoon at the Methodist Church in charge of the Rev. C. E. Luce.

Matilda Johnson was born at Deerfield, Illinois, December 30, 1887, and was married to Theodore Johnson of Melvin, Illinois, February 13, 1906. They lived in Algona and came to Rockford in 1928.

She is survived by her husband and six children and three stepchildren; Mrs. Harold Price, Mason City; Mrs. Henry Miller, Luverne; Leroy, Mason City; Theodore R., Ferna; and Florence of Rockford; Mrs. Ernest Hutchinson, Wesley; Mrs. Sam Bichel, Melvin, Illinois; and Clayton of Wesley; also her parents, Mr. and Mrs. George Bentz of Melvin, Illinois; and seven brothers; Edward, Ethan, South Dakota; Harry, Phillip, George and Albert, Melvin, Illinois; and Raymond of Wisconsin; and one sister; Mrs. J. Schrock of Dundee, Ohio.

Mason City Globe Gazette, Tuesday October 20, 1931
